So anyway, I have spent some months building something between a raft and a boat. It's a 5 meters long and 3 meters wide catamaran. The hulls are made from polystyrene foam which I've cut/glued/shaped and painted with a special protective coating. The deck is made from the same kind of wood you would normally use to build a veranda. It will eventually have a home-made mast and sails and I'd like to put a motor on it.

I'd really love that motor to be electric, they're so lovely and quiet and, being a boat, I suppose I don't have the same weight concerns as a car builder would have. I know there are a few electric outboards on the market but I've not seen one powerflul enough to shift anything bigger than a canoe, and they are very expensive (cost is a big thing in this project.)

So, I'd like to build one myself. Here's where the fun starts. The most advanced thing I've ever built that's electric powered is a radio control car from a kit. I don't know aything about what motor to choose, what kind of battery is the best option for a boat, etc etc. Can anyone help me here? Here are some things I've noted that I need to think about when choosing equipment:

1) The boat is heavy and it will be in a slow moving river - I need something with a bit of oomph, I want to feel like I'm really getting somewhere, but this is not a speed boat. I suppose something like 5-10 horsepower would be fine.

2) I want to be able to travel for hours on a single charge, running out of power would be a bad thing since the way home is upstream.

3) I can charge the batteries from it's mooring since I can just run an extention lead down there from the shed, so they don't have to be super light and portable...as long as the boat floats... :roll:

4) It doesn't have to be an outboard, it's probably easier to build an inboard motor I imagine.

5) I do have a friend who's an electrician if expertise is needed in the installation.

6) The winter can be as low as -20 degrees celcius here (but not likely to go that low these days, although below zero is very common). I don't know how much of an impact that makes on my options.

Hi Deddly.

Before you spend too much time and money on your project, I would suggest you do some research on battery performance for use in cold application/s.
Many batteries cannot function well in the mode you wish to use in cold weather.

The Lynch motor is well suited for your application.
They are not cheap, secondhand ones are available.

Try to find an outboard leg with a worn/damaged engine.
An engineering shop or good home based hobby engineer should be able to attach a Lynch motor to an outboard leg.

Do polish the propellor, I found this helps with low powered outboards.

The Lynch 200 mm motor will work from 12 volts, although at 24 volts to 60 volts it is most efficient.

In the cold conditions you may use your boat, personally I would have an ICE generator on board, connected to your battery charger for emergency use to get you upstream.

Hmm, I'm just about to set too on an outboard conversion myself.
Other choices for motor are the new "Etek-r" and "-RT" motors, or even a Perm 132 is cheaper than a lynch I believe. Cheapest of all is the "mars brushless etek", with the added bonus of no brushes to wear out, though lower power than the above.
If you intend to use the boat in the winter, then plump for LifePo4 type batteries, these suffer far less in the cold than most other types I've found. They are a little pricier, but it will pay off in the long run when they return you a much longer life than just about any other cells.

My conversion will be for a customers yacht, and he tell me he has a device which he can trail out the back whilst sailing, with a prop of some kind that charges his lead acids. He intends to buy more to help charge his batteries on the fly. Could you find a way to "dangle" one of these down the local sluice for some free juice? :roll:

Don't worry too much about using lead acid batteries in winter. The answer is to keep them warm, so make sure they are insulated and then keep them warm either with a heated belt powered by a solar panel or with a simple home-made hot water solar panel.

As a solution its far cheaper than using them thar posh batteries.

The cheapest and best solution would be to get an old broken outboard petrol motor - I scrapped one last year which would have been ideal - and then use that as a base. Brushed motors are easier to set up than brushless, because you don't need such an expensive controller to get them going.

Scrapyards and the Bay of E sound like the haunting grounds you ought to be searching.

I picked up a couple of 12-48v 2kW electric motors earlier this year for £35 the pair on eBay, and the smaller 500w-1kW motors are available for sub-£30, you often see outboard motors down at scrapyards.

Will a starter motor do the trick? Probably. And they're cheap to buy. Again, head off to the scrapyard and see what you can find.

As for batteries, back to eBay again for those: you're after some traction batteries or leisure batteries or industrial batteries that have had an untroubled life in an industrial UPS.

I would suggest you can do without a clever controller - you either have an on-off switch or a potentiometer to provide speed control.

Alternatively, you go onto eBay and buy yourself an electric scooter or disability wagon. You'll have the motor, the controller, the batteries and the charger, all in one go.
